Copying From a Camera Copying Playlist This mode allows you to record videos within a Playlist created on your camera. For details on creating a Playlist, refer to your camera's operating instructions. Before selecting this copy mode, turn on the DVDirect (page 29), insert a disc (page 30) and connect cables for recording (page 31). 1 Make sure that the copy mode select screen appears. When the DVDirect detects signals from a camera connecting to the USB port or memory card inserted into the slot, the copy mode select screen appears. Number of required discs Type of input 2 Press V or v to select [Playlist] and press b. z Hint • If you do not need to select the type of images, simply select [Playlist] and press the (record) button to start recording. Go straight to step 5. 3 Make sure that the type of Playlist images you wish to copy is marked. Press V or v to select a Playlist to copy. Pressing the ENTER button toggles the selection between marked and unmarked. Marked video to copy If both [HD Video] and [SD Video] types are selected for recording: HD (High Definition) and SD (Standard Definition) videos are recorded onto separate discs. For details, see "Notes on copying multiple types of image" on page 23. b Note • You cannot select image types that cannot be recorded. (For example, a camera or memory card containing no video/photo data, or standard definition (SD) video taken by another digital video camera.) 43
